|
@@ -4,9 +4,40 @@ choice
|
|
|
prompt "Texas Instruments' K3 based SoC select"
|
|
|
optional
|
|
|
|
|
|
+config SOC_K3_AM6
|
|
|
+ bool "TI's K3 based AM6 SoC Family Support"
|
|
|
+
|
|
|
endchoice
|
|
|
|
|
|
config SYS_SOC
|
|
|
default "k3"
|
|
|
|
|
|
+config SYS_K3_NON_SECURE_MSRAM_SIZE
|
|
|
+ hex
|
|
|
+ default 0x80000
|
|
|
+ help
|
|
|
+ Describes the total size of the MCU MSRAM. This doesn't
|
|
|
+ specify the total size of SPL as ROM can use some part
|
|
|
+ of this RAM. Once ROM gives control to SPL then this
|
|
|
+ complete size can be usable.
|
|
|
+
|
|
|
+config SYS_K3_MAX_DOWNLODABLE_IMAGE_SIZE
|
|
|
+ hex
|
|
|
+ default 0x58000
|
|
|
+ help
|
|
|
+ Describes the maximum size of the image that ROM can download
|
|
|
+ from any boot media.
|
|
|
+
|
|
|
+config SYS_K3_MCU_SCRATCHPAD_BASE
|
|
|
+ hex
|
|
|
+ default 0x40280000 if SOC_K3_AM6
|
|
|
+ help
|
|
|
+ Describes the base address of MCU Scratchpad RAM.
|
|
|
+
|
|
|
+config SYS_K3_MCU_SCRATCHPAD_SIZE
|
|
|
+ hex
|
|
|
+ default 0x200 if SOC_K3_AM6
|
|
|
+ help
|
|
|
+ Describes the size of MCU Scratchpad RAM.
|
|
|
+
|
|
|
endif
|